Cox Farms

We had a wonderful family adventure at Cox Farms last weekend. I absolutely love this place! They have farm animals, slides and rope swings, climbing hay mountains, hay rides, apple cider, and pumpkins, pumpkins and more pumpkins. The slides are so much fun because all of us can partake - Alex was brave enough to go by himself but Hannah had to sit on my lap. Each slide has a different theme: volcano, miner's mine shaft, winding slide through the pig barn, dinosaur's back, etc. Alex liked the miner slide because it was bumpy and went through a long tunnel; I liked the winding slide through the pig barn; but we all loved the gigantic dinosaur slide.
